A wheel hub liner trimming device
By combining a ring cutter, a straight cutter, and an automatic material feeding structure, the problem of scrap material accumulation during the cutting of the metal plate inside the wheel hub is solved, realizing automated cleaning and waste recycling, and improving production efficiency and operational continuity.

AI Technical Summary
In the existing technology, when the metal sheet of the wheel hub inner liner is extruded and trimmed, the scraps accumulate on the operating table, which interferes with subsequent operations and requires frequent manual cleaning, increasing labor intensity and time costs.
Design a wheel hub inner liner trimming device, which uses a ring cutter and a straight cutter in conjunction with an inclined unloading plate. The scrap material slides down the unloading plate, and combined with a movable rotating ring and a geared motor to drive the push plate, the scrap material is automatically cleaned to the waste port, realizing automated recycling.
It effectively avoids scraps interfering with subsequent operations, reduces the need for manual cleaning, improves production efficiency, and enables centralized recycling and disposal of waste.

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of wheel hub inner liner processing technology, specifically a wheel hub inner liner trimming device. Background Technology
[0002] The extrusion and trimming of the wheel hub inner liner is a key process in wheel hub production for forming the metal inner liner plate. Its core lies in processing the metal sheet into a wheel hub inner liner prototype that meets the specifications through the synergistic action of mechanical extrusion and shearing.
[0003] In the existing technology, when the metal plate of the wheel hub liner is extruded and trimmed, the resulting scraps will accumulate on the operating table and be distributed around the metal plate, interfering with the normal progress of subsequent trimming operations. Frequent manual cleaning is also required, which increases labor intensity and time costs. Therefore, a wheel hub liner trimming device is needed to meet people's needs. Utility Model Content
[0004] The purpose of this utility model is to provide a wheel hub inner liner trimming device to solve the problem mentioned in the background art that when the metal plate of the wheel hub inner liner is extruded and trimmed, the resulting scrap material will accumulate on the operating table, interfering with the normal operation of subsequent operations, and requiring frequent manual cleaning.

[0029] The working principle is as follows:
[0030] The annular indentation 102 and the straight indentation 103 on the inner metal plate 101 are the initial indentations. Rollers with preset patterns or grooves are used to press the metal plate, creating indentations on the material surface that match the shape of the cutting blade in the subsequent extrusion and trimming device. This provides a positioning reference or guide trajectory for the subsequent extrusion and trimming process. During trimming, several inner metal plates 101 can be stacked on top of the annular cutter 201, aligning the annular cutter 201 with the annular indentation 102, while simultaneously aligning the straight cutter 202 with the straight indentation 103. Then, the hydraulic cylinder 105 is activated, causing the pressure plate 106 to press the inner metal plate 101 downwards. When the inner metal plate 101 is pressed down, it is subjected to annular... The shearing action of the annular cutter 201 and the straight cutter 202 involves the annular cutter 201 cutting along the position of the annular indentation 102, while the straight cutter 202 cutting along the position of the straight indentation 103. Ultimately, the inner liner metal plate 101 retains its middle portion due to the pattern formed by the annular indentation 102 and the straight indentation 103. The cut inner liner metal plate 101 falls into the discharge hole 204 and then slides out from the discharge port 205, thus completing the unloading. Several scrap pieces are formed around the inner liner metal plate 101. The unloading plate 203 can be designed with a 55-degree angle so that the scrap pieces slide down the slope of the unloading plate 203 into the annular baffle 300.
[0031] The geared motor 303 is turned on to drive the linkage gear 304 to rotate. The rotating linkage gear 304, through meshing with the gear ring 302, drives the movable rotating ring 301 to rotate. The continuously rotating movable rotating ring 301 drives several push plates 305 to perform circumferential motion between the annular baffle 300 and the mounting bracket 200. At the same time, it agitates the scrap material inside the annular baffle 300, pushing the scrap material towards the waste outlet 306. Finally, the scrap material can slide out from the waste outlet 306. A receiving frame can be set below the waste outlet 306. To facilitate the recycling of scrap materials, when the push plate 305 wears or deforms over time, the mounting bolt 310 can be rotated and unscrewed from the screw hole 311 to release the position restriction of the push plate 305. Then, the push plate 305 can be pulled off the positioning rod 309 to complete the disassembly. When installing a new push plate 305, it can be fitted onto the positioning rod 309 through the positioning hole 308, and then the mounting bolt 310 can be screwed back into the screw hole 311 to fix the position of the push plate 305.
